Output 77a077d06b05fed537139d0b91483693bbfe7bb50df27ca0134e58ee720fb18a:0

value
3866182
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62519a72cc5abcc8f4283f6a7f864e5c520eae2d OP_EQUAL
address
3AesuEvKU8JybHpQoabjv1VAm2a3LvCzE5
transaction
77a077d06b05fed537139d0b91483693bbfe7bb50df27ca0134e58ee720fb18a
spent
true